Job Description: Performs work in the operation of a vehicle to assure safe transportation of clients to and from various destinations and to assist clients on entry and exit from vehicles as necessary.
- Working knowledge of the rules and regulations involved in the safe and efficient operation of automotive equipment.
- Knowledge of basic automotive maintenance procedures.
- Ability to deal effectively and patiently with others.
- Ability to operate a van or small bus.
- Ability to understand and follow oral and written instructions.
- Ability to lift weights of 40-60 lbs.
- Must be reliable and flexible
- Must have good communication and organizational skills
Qualifications:
- Must have a Valid Class 5 Driver?s License
- Must provide a clear drivers abstract
- First Aid & CPR
- Must provide a clear Criminal Record Check and Child Abuse check
- Must have strong knowledge of Metis & First Nations culture
